With the seven play-off matches from this weekend now done, here are the results of the second legs.
17:35 | FULL-TIME
As Jana Knedlikova scores her fourth goal of the game Vipers' victory is wrapped up. Odense mounted a really strong comeback but Vipers, today, were good enough to take the win and the quarter-final ticket with a 65:62 aggregate victory.

The DELO EHF Champions League is ready for the play-offs. This and next weekend, 16 teams will battle it out for the eight coveted tickets to the quarter-final.
A total of 28 matches still awaits us before this season’s champions will be crowned at the DELO EHF FINAL4 in Budapest on 29/30 May.
Let’s have a look at the most interesting facts and figures after the completion of the challenging group phase:
1 team remained unbeaten in the group phase: Defending champions Györ won 10 times and had four draws in their 14 matches.
